Pull&Bear

Across from Main Terminal check-in, Pull&Bear is your fast-fashion stop

Right in the Main Terminal landside area, Pull&Bear works for last-minute clothes when your bag is light or your hoodie is stuck in checked luggage. It runs typical mall hours, roughly 10:00 to 21:00, matching most TIJ departures to Mexico City, Guadalajara, and beyond. You’re still before security here, so factor in at least 20–30 minutes to clear formalities after you’re done browsing.

Pricing sits in standard Pull&Bear territory: graphic tees usually land in the MX$250–400 range, jeans around MX$600–900, and seasonal jackets can creep over MX$1,000. Stock skews younger: logo hoodies, joggers, basic denim, and casual sneakers more than business shirts. If you just need a fresh T-shirt before a CBX crossing or a red-eye, you’ll probably find something without wrecking your budget.

The store carries both men’s and women’s lines, with plenty of XS–L pieces, though XL and above can be hit-or-miss on any given day. Expect the usual wall of denim, a few tables of seasonal basics, and a corner with accessories like caps and small backpacks under MX$500. Don’t come here for formalwear or luggage; this is about off-duty clothes and quick replacements.

Plan one simple pass: in through the denim wall, loop by sneakers, then accessories, and be out in 15 minutes. If your flight from the Main Terminal boards in under an hour, shop first, then head straight to security so you’re at the gate at least 25 minutes before departure.
